Where to Stay in Kailua Kona: Discover Historic Kailua Village

Nestled on the Big Island’s stunning west coast, Historic Kailua Village offers an authentic Hawaiian experience that attracts travelers seeking both adventure and relaxation. Known for its rich history as the former capital of the Hawaiian Kingdom, Kailua-Kona boasts beautiful oceanfront views, charming shops, and delectable local cuisine. The warm, sunny climate paired with breathtaking sunsets makes this destination a true paradise. Don’t miss the chance to explore the vibrant local culture, including traditional hula performances and artisan markets that showcase the best of island craftsmanship.

Summary: Amazing property for location, design, convenience, and amenities. I had 36 people (close friends and family) on the property and we were all very comfortable. We occupied all units on property. Everyone appreciated that we all could hang out, but still have our own space with our smaller groups. The backyard area is fantastic and the quality and design of all the units are top-notch. We also had a wedding on the property that turned out very well. Near the property are a lot of different shops and restaurants. The property is also close enough to the airport where I was easily able to shuttle people back and forth to save on car rentals. Jill, the property manager, was super helpful and almost always available since she does reside on the property. A couple of the AC units and the jacuzzi stopped working properly during our stay and she was very diligent in addressing those issues. Our goal for this trip was to find a property that could hold all 36 of us for a wedding and for a fun vacation where we could all hang out together along with the option for people to do their own thing around the island. This one was perfect for that and we highly recommend it! The following are bits of feedback from us that we feel could improve the property. Based on the website, we initially interpreted the layout of the property as 6 separate buildings, but it’s actually more like 3 duplexes. Parking is a bit tricky. We fit 4 vans and 1 Jeep pretty easily divided between the upper and lower lots. Any more than that would include a lot of shuffling cars around which is already not the easiest as there is limited space. Fortunately, additional vehicles can be parked along the street just outside the property. We think that a part of the wall on the lower lot could be opened up to make backing out of the lower lot easier. The property is not the easiest to find as there is no sign for it or no distinct address that we could identify. The jacuzzi was also not working properly for most of our stay which was a bummer since our reservation was well in advance enough that it could have been checked for proper functionality. It would be good to notice potential guests if other units will be occupied during their stay. The property is perfect for groups that are comfortable with each other and such, but we’re unsure how it would play out if all 6 units had 6 random groups together. Overall an amazing spot to be at though!
